And finishing up the Hanna-Barbera collection of NES games is 'Wacky Races', developed by Atlus and released in the May 1992 (US). Wacky Races is definitely one of the lesser-known Hanna-Barbera cartoons, as it ran for only one season in the late 1960s. The cartoon revolves around several racers with various themes who are each allowed to use strange gimmicks to compete against other racers in many races across the United States.

So, first off let's pull the band-aid off real quick. There's no racing whatsoever in this game lol. It's a platformer where the player controls 'Muttley' through three different areas. All three must be completed to reach the game's ending. The first two areas have three stages each, while Go Go America has four. The player can jump and initially use a short-ranged bite attack, but by collecting bones, the player can swap them in a fashion reminiscent of the Gradius series for a bomb attack, a flying "bark shot", the ability to glide with Muttley's tail, and extra health. Each of the ten stages ends in a boss battle against one of the other ten racers. Defeating one will clear the current stage and defeating all three/four in that area will allow progression to the next area.

I'm a fan of Atlus definitely and while the gameplay doesn't live up to other cherished titles I've played (Rockin' Kats comes to mind), there's more good than bad here. The only lacking is any sort of serious challenge and well... racing
